Rivertrust Federal Credit Union has proudly served its members since its founding on August 8, 1935. Originally chartered as Jackson Miss Telco Employees Federal Credit Union, the organization was renamed Mississippi Telco Federal Credit Union on April 30, 1940.
What began as a small, member-focused institution has grown into a multi-million-dollar financial cooperative made possible by the continued trust and support of our members.
Our success has always been rooted in the commitment of our members who choose to save, borrow, and support one another through the credit union difference. Dedicated volunteers have also played a vital role over the years, serving on the Board of Directors and committees to guide our growth and direction.
Continued growth led to key milestones, including the opening of our main office in Pearl, Mississippi, in 2000. In 2016, we adopted the name Rivertrust Federal Credit Union to better reflect our broader field of membership and members and organizations we serve.
